$(document).ready(function(){
var flag = 1;
$("#delBtn").click(function(){
var checked = [];
flag = 0;
$('input:checkbox:checked').each(function() {
checked.push($(this).val());
});
$.ajax({
type: 'POST',//提交方式 post 或者get
url: "/designclass/serial/delSeriInfo.do",//提交到那里 后他的服务
cache : false,
traditional :true, //必须加上该句话来序列化
data: {'checked':checked},//提交的参数
success:function(msg){
alert("成功了");//弹出窗口,这里的msg 参数 就是访问aaaa.action 后 后台给的参数
},
error:function(){
ajax("提交失败的处理函数!");
}
});
//alert(checked);
});
});在后台进行接收,我用的是springmvc
@RequestMapping("/delSeriInfo.do")
public String delSeriInfo(@RequestParam("checked") String []id,HttpServletRequest req,ModelMap mm){
//String []id = req.getParameterValues("checked");//或者也可以这样得到
System.out.println(id[0]+"******"+id[1]);
String currentPage = req.getSession().getAttribute("currentPage").toString();
getSeriInfos(currentPage, req, mm);
return "index";
}
使用jQuery与Ajax实现页面元素批量删除操作
本文介绍了一种使用jQuery和Ajax技术在网页上实现多个元素快速批量删除的方法,通过监听删除按钮事件,收集被选中元素的ID,并通过AJAX请求将这些ID传递给后台进行数据删除操作。

被折叠的 条评论
为什么被折叠?



